Dick’s Sporting Goods latest super store is set to open in Brandon Oct. 31.
The Pittsburgh retailer will officially open its new House of Sport concept at the Brandon Exchange mall in suburban Tampa on Halloween with a ceremonial ribbon cutting and a weekend’s worth of events.
The store is on the east side of the 1.1 million-square-foot mall in an anchor space previously occupied by Sears and vacant for at least four years.
The House of Sport stores are about 100,000 square feet and feature rock climbing walls and multiple golf bays with TrackMan simulators along with the company’s traditional product offerings. The stores also have multi-sport cages for baseball, softball, lacrosse and soccer to give athletes an opportunity to try products while measuring and tracking their performance.
Dick’s launched what it calls its “multi-sport experiential” stores in 2021 and currently has two open in the state, one at Tampa’s International Plaza and the other in Miami. A sign for a coming soon House of Sport location hangs in the parking lot at the Mall at University Town Center in Sarasota, as well.

Dick’s, which recently closed on the purchase of Foot Locker for $2.4 billion, has 723 stores nationwide, including 19 House of Sport locations as of Aug. 2.
In Florida, it has 40 stores with 11 along the Gulf Coast.
